Ring and ball material

 

 

The material used for ball bearing components must have good wear resistance, show good resistance to shock loads and to corrosion as well as a good dimensional stability.

 

Chrome steel 100 Cr6 for ball bearings is used for the production of rings and balls for standard WIB ball bearings. The 100 Cr6 rings, having been subjected to special heat treatment, have a hardness of 60 to 64 HRC, the balls of 62 to 65 HRC.

 

Stainless steel is also used by WIB, mainly for the manufacture of ultra-light (618xx and 619xx) and special bearings. The rings are made of X 65 Cr 13 (ACD 34) and the balls of X 105 CrMo 17 (440 C) stainless steel. They have a minimum hardness of 58 HRC after heat treatment.

 

For specific applications, special steels with particular properties may be used. For example, it is possible to use X 155 CrVMo 12.1 (DIN 1.2379) steel for the outer ring of a bearing requiring very high wear resistance of the contact surfaces.

 

Hybrid bearings may be obtained by associating rings and balls of 100 Cr6 steel, stainless steel or ceramic. The ceramic balls have a hardness of approximately 80 HRC. They increase the wear and corrosion resistance, allow a higher limiting speed and reduce the bearing noise as well as deformations. The result is better stability of the initial clearances and an increase of the ball bearing service life. Ceramic balls also provide better thermal and electrical insulation.

 

The 100 Cr6 steel rings produced by WIB are stabilized by annealing after hardening and can be used at temperatures up to 150°C.
